Step 3 (If Applicable): Are you Covering Tuition and/or Fees?
If your GRA is not GSSP eligible for tuition or you are sponsoring their fees, you must indicate this on the online hiring request form. Students can check if they are eligible by Checking their GSSP status. Project number and amount must go in the “Supervisor Comments”.
- For ECE/ASSIST/CLAWS/ICONS/FREEDM: Specify this on the online hiring request form.
- For Power America: Email your HR Rep with the student’s name, ID #, project number, and the amount to be paid.
- Important: State funds cannot be used for tuition or fees. Please review the rules regarding support for RAs appointed at 0.25 FTE.
Crucial Information on GSSP Benefits
- Census Day is the Final Cutoff: Any GRA whose appointment is not fully processed by Census Day will forfeit their GSSP tuition remission and health insurance for the entire Fall semester. The student or the PI will be responsible for these costs.
- Health Insurance: Students must be hired before census, to activate their Spring health insurance.
- Appointment Length: All GRA appointments must extend through the end of the semester. If a student’s appointment is terminated early, their tuition benefits will be prorated, and they will be billed for the difference.
